kyle works at a donut factory where a 10-oz cup of coffee costs 95 cents, a 14-oz cup costs $1.15, and a 20-oz cup costs $1.50.
8_murik_8 [283]

Answer:

The number of a 10-oz cup of coffee was 6

The number of a 14-oz cup of coffee was 6

The number of a 20-oz cup of coffee was 5

Step-by-step explanation:

Let

x ----> the number of a 10-oz cup of coffee

y ----> the number of a 14-oz cup of coffee

z ----> the number of a 20-oz cup of coffee

we know that

x+y+z=17 -----> equation A

10x+14y+20z=244 ----> equation B

0.95x+1.15y+1.50z=20.10 ----> equation C

Using a equation System Solver (Wolfram Alpha)

The solution is

x=6, y=6, z=5

see the attached figure

therefore

The number of a 10-oz cup of coffee was 6

The number of a 14-oz cup of coffee was 6

The number of a 20-oz cup of coffee was 5

Se ha determinado que la población P (t) de una colonia de bacterias, t horas después de iniciar la observación, tiene una razón
maxonik [38]

Answer:

La población 20 horas después será de 321,161 bacterias.

Step-by-step explanation:

t horas después de iniciar la observación, tiene una razón de cambio de P'(t) = 350 e0.18t + 220 e-0.3t.

Esto implica que la población después de t horas viene dada por:

P(t) = \int P^{\prime}(t) dt

P(t) = \int (350e^{0.18t} + 220e^{-0.3t}) dt

Teniendo en cuenta que

\int e^{at} dt = \frac{1}{a}e^{at}

P(t) = \int (350e^{0.18t} + 220e^{-0.3t}) dt

P(t) = \frac{350}{0.18}e^{0.18t} - \frac{220}{0.3}e^{-0.3t} + K

En que k es la población inicial, o sea, K = 250000. Entonces

P(t) = 1944.44e^{0.18t} -733.33e^{-0.3t} + 250000

¿Cuál será la población 20 horas después?

Esto eres P(20). Entonces:

P(20) = 1944.44e^{0.18*20} -733.33e^{-0.3*20} + 250000 = 321161

La población 20 horas después será de 321,161 bacterias.
